Embedded QA Engineer (Manual/Automation) Offline

Client – the worldwide manufacturer of smart beds, which increase the overall quality of sleep. The solution senses and automatically adjusts the comfort level:

 

- Tracking personal sleep data during the night

- Individual comfort and temperature balancing

- Comfort adjustability on each side of the bed

 

Requirements:

 

Bachelor’s degree in Computer Science, Computer Engineering or similar technical field required

2-3 years of experience in a software development organization with a solid understanding of QA fundamentals

Сreate well-organized test automation libraries and test suites for embedded devices

Strong experience with Python (preferred) or C, Java

Implement and improve existing CI/CD infrastructure processes and procedures

Experience working in an AWS environment is a plus

Strong analytical, problem solving, and communication abilities

Strong knowledge of source control management, coding standards, code review, and build and release processes (e.g. Git, Jenkins)

Scripting skills in bash and similar environments are helpful

Desired knowledge of and experience with the Robot Framework for automated testing

 

Preferences:

 

AWS, C, Java

 

Responsibilities:

 

Responsible for the testing and quality of embedded Software and Firmware components of a IoT device (millions of users)

Development and document the test automation frameworks and tools used for both embedded IoT and backend web application testing

Develop the automated test cases to validate that software products meet both engineering and product requirements.

Create test plans and test cases based on functional documentation and/or application behavior(s)

Support the adoption, use, and expansion of automated testing across the various teams

Generate test execution summary reports

Debug and troubleshoot in a RTOS/Linux environment

Maintain the high standard for all code and scripts

Provide code reviews and approvals

Work closely with Architects, Developers, DevOps, Product Owners and QA team members to produce high-quality products

Support the prioritization of deliverables in a dynamic environment

The job ad is no longer active
Job unpublished on 16 October 2020

Look at the current jobs QA Automation Kyiv→

Loading...